Job description

Form the Future is an award-winning social enterprise on a mission to improve life chances by connecting young people to the world of work. We work in the East of England and beyond, delivering impactful careers programmes in schools and colleges, and building powerful partnerships with employers, educators and local authorities.

We are now looking for an outstanding Chief Programme Officer to join our senior leadership team. This is a unique opportunity for a strategic, values-led leader to drive the next phase of our development, translating policy into practice, leading an exceptional team, and ensuring we deliver measurable change for young people.

About the Role

As Chief Programme Officer, you will lead the design and delivery of our programmes and services, ensuring they remain responsive to emerging needs and aligned with our mission. You will bring clarity, coherence and ambition to our delivery strategy, connecting the big picture to day-to-day actions.

We’re looking for someone who can unify and inspire a multidisciplinary team, while commanding credibility across the careers and skills ecosystem. You’ll be adept at working with a wide range of stakeholders, from schools and employers to local authorities, government agencies, and funders. You’ll have the confidence to represent us as an expert in what works in careers education, and the humility to keep learning.

What You’ll Bring

  • A track record of senior leadership in a relevant field (e.g. education, skills, youth employment, social impact).
  • The ability to turn government policy into practical, fundable, scalable interventions.
  • A strategic mindset with experience in outcome-based planning (ideally including OKRs).
  • Strong people leadership skills and a collaborative, empowering style.
  • An understanding of the needs and motivations of all our client groups - students, educators, employers, and investors.
  • Personal credibility and warmth, someone who brings both gravitas and kindness to their leadership.

Why Join Us?

This is a senior role in a respected, mission-driven organisation that is making a tangible difference in young people’s lives. You’ll work alongside a passionate, supportive team and have the autonomy to shape strategy, culture and impact. We offer flexible working, a collaborative culture, and a genuine commitment to learning and innovation.
